Etymology
Etymology tree
Borrowed from Spanish Jesús, from Latin Iēsūs, borrowed from Ancient Greek Ἰησοῦς (Iēsoûs), borrowed from Hebrew יֵשׁוּעַ (yeshúa, yēšū́aʿ), from Biblical Hebrew יְהוֹשֻׁעַ (y'hoshúa, yĕhōšúaʿ), possibly from הוֹשֵׁעַ (hoshéa, hōšḗaʿ). Doublet of Sisos.
